Joint Press Release: The Latin Patriarchate of Jerusalem and the Custody of the Holy Land

This morning, the Israeli Police prevented the Latin Patriarch of Jerusalem together with the Custos of the Holy Land from entering the Church of the Holy Sepulchre in Jerusalem, as they made their way to celebrate the Palm Sunday Mass.
